Straight to Heaven is this intriguing little gem from '96 that blends fantasy with a touch of whimsy. The plot centers around two girls in love, who find themselves caught in a traffic jam in Mexico City. The pacing is relaxed, allowing the viewer to soak in the atmosphere, which is both magical and dreamy. It might not have a renowned director, but the film’s distinct visual style and practical effects create a unique world that feels almost tangible. The performances are heartfelt, capturing the innocence and yearning of young love. It’s all about that journey, both literally and metaphorically. A lovely exploration of escape and the idea of finding paradise in unexpected places.
